Job responsibilities

The post holder will be responsible for:

Dispensing Duties:

To interpret and dispense prescriptions on a patient specific basis for in-patients and discharge under the supervision of a team pharmacist/accuracy checking technician.

Ensuring all work is carried out to a high degree of accuracy, safely and efficiently following current standard operating procedures of the department on a daily basis.

To successfully complete, a dispensing accuracy assessment to demonstrate competency in dispensing on an on-going basis and once completed to maintain competency accordingly.

To input prescription data into the pharmacy computer system ensuring high levels of accuracy.

To supply controlled drugs on request from designated clinical areas and for discharge / outpatient prescriptions, in accordance with departmental procedures and in compliance with related legislation regarding record keeping, storage and transportation of controlled drugs.

To maintain and replenish identified stock or emergency supplies on a daily basis. To record and monitor medicines room and refrigerator temperatures as delegated to ensure storage conditions are within the defined parameters.

To replace or rotate short dated medicines where appropriate to minimise wastage.

Support with stock checks

To relay complete and accurate information, recognising self-limitations and referring to appropriate person.

To take appropriate daily action to ensure medication requiring delivery is available to individual patients.

To plan own work, liaising with manager to ensure appropriate management of ward/clinical area work.

Other Duties and Responsibilities:

To dispose of waste products according to the Trust waste policy including appropriate handling of corrosive materials, cytotoxics and flammable substances.

To identify stock shortages and place orders communicating with the Acute Unit staff regarding urgency and availability.

To use a variety of communication techniques appropriate to circumstances preventing barriers to understanding in order to provide advice to patients on the medicine supply, estimating waiting times, arranging for items to be ordered/delivered. To assist patients in obtaining necessary medicine supplies e.g. liaising between the doctor and the patient to ensure that prescriptions are available where appropriate. To respect the patients confidentiality and the sensitive nature of information. Confirming the patients understanding

To undertake, complete and pass mandatory and recommended training programmes.

To carry out record keeping and data collection data for audit purposes.

To comply with requirements of statutory regulations, including Medicines Act, Misuse of Drugs Act and Regulations, Health and Safety at Work Act, Control of Substances Hazardous to Health (COSHH), etc. and local operating procedures to ensure that the work is to a high standard (accurate).

To maintain the security of the medicines within Pharmacy departments at all times To undertake other duties commensurate with this grade of post in agreement with the relevant line manager according to service requirements.
